摘要
Our preliminary data show that erlotinib inhibits Triple-negative breast cancer (TNBC) in a xenograft model. However, inhibition of metastasis by erlotinib is accompanied by nonspecific effects because erlotinib can inhibit other kinases; thus, more direct targets that regulate TNBC metastasis need to be identified to improve its therapeutic efficacy.
